. >> i'm dana king. it was a close vote with billions on the line. >> the election is over but the battle over a sales tax measure in alameda county is taking a new turn. after losing by a narrow margin, a county agency is asking for an expensive recounty. cbs 5 reporter mike sugerman says taxpayers are being asked to pay for it. >> reporter: transportation officials in alameda county really wanted this megabillion ballot measure. it was so close. but they didn't get it. so they are now spending more money to see if they can still get it and as you say that angers a lot of taxpayers. tick, tick, tick. >> yes. yes, yes. >> reporter: someone likened it to watching paint dry. >> yes, yes. >> reporter: most alameda county voters voted for measure b-1, 66.53% of them. but it needed two-thirds majority, 66.67%. the backers of the half cent sales tax that would fix potholes boost bus service and bring bart to livermore decided to buy a recount. >> we have been working on developing this transportation expenditu

. >> i'm dana king. a made in america is the latest interest apple. they are about to spend millions to begin making computers in the united states again. cbs 5 reporter len ramirez on how the company's trying to tap into a hot new consumer tren. len. >> it's a growing trend in the u.s. apple back in the day when it still had rainbow colors on it, and it was known as apple computers, it manufactured its computers here in the bay area in fremont. over the decades that's changed. but now it appears that it's coming back although not in a big way. apple fans love their iphones but ever look at the fine print? assembled in china. all apple products are made in china but that's about to change. >> on to the macintosh. >> reporter: ceo tim cook announced today that starting next year one line of macintosh computers will be designed and built in the u.s. cnet says with one like of macs and not the more popular iphone or ipad apple isn't taking a big risk but is making a statement. >> this is a big deal. it's a big differentiator for this company. >> reporter
